1997 CENSUS OF AGRICULTURE HIGHLIGHTS OF AGRICULTURE: 1997 AND 1992 ARENAC COUNTY, MICHIGAN Item ALL FARMS 1997 1992 Farms .........................number.. 325 276 Land in farms ..................acres.. 86 240 82 418 Average size of farm .......acres.. 265 299 Value of land and buildings@1: Average per farm .........dollars.. 325 842 270 205 Average per acre .........dollars.. 1 286 865 Estimated market value of all machinery and equipment@1 Average per farm .........dollars.. 86 691 69 294 Farms by size: 1 to 9 acres ........................ 8 5 10 to 49 acres ...................... 50 43 50 to 179 acres ..................... 135 92 180 to 499 acres .................... 90 84 500 to 999 acres .................... 25 37 1,000 acres or more ................. 17 15 Total cropland .................farms.. 305 272 acres.. 69 417 66 272 Harvested cropland ...........farms.. 237 260 acres.. 56 792 52 391 Irrigated land .................farms.. 10 12 acres.. 870 1 067 Market value of agricultural products sold................$1,000.. 23 118 19 651 Average per farm .........dollars.. 71 133 71 198 Crops, including nursery and greenhouse crops............$1,000.. 16 441 13 355 Livestock, poultry, and their products....................$1,000.. 6 677 6 296 Farms by value of sales: Less than $2,500 .................... 115 50 $2,500 to $4,999 .................... 23 20 $5,000 to $9,999 .................... 31 42 $10,000 to $24,999 .................. 37 38 $25,000 to $49,999 .................. 26 36 $50,000 to $99,999 .................. 32 37 $100,000 or more .................... 61 53 Total farm production expenses.$1,000.. 15 490 13 588 Average per farm .........dollars.. 47 808 49 232 Operators by principal occupation: Farming ............................. 167 177 Other ............................... 158 99 Operators by days worked off farm: Any ................................. 157 115 200 days or more ................... 103 75 Livestock and poultry: Cattle and calves inventory...farms.. 82 92 number.. 7 177 7 148 Beef cows ..................farms.. 27 22 number.. 430 294 Milk cows ..................farms.. 25 41 number.. 2 379 2 872 Cattle and calves sold .......farms.. 75 85 number.. 2 366 2 596 Hogs and pigs inventory ......farms.. 13 20 number.. 1 207 4 697 Hogs and pigs sold ...........farms.. 9 18 number.. 1 628 5 122 Sheep and lambs inventory ....farms.. 3 8 number.. (D) 164 Layers and pullets 13 weeks old and older inventory.............farms.. 8 15 number.. (D) 478 Broilers and other meat-type chickens sold...............farms.. 0 0 number.. 0 0 Selected crops harvested: Corn for grain or seed .......farms.. 121 131 acres.. 14 348 13 344 bushels.. 1 650 694 1 059 270 Wheat for grain ..............farms.. 93 106 acres.. 5 430 4 735 bushels.. 334 443 281 866 Soybeans for beans ...........farms.. 98 79 acres.. 8 408 4 770 bushels.. 293 071 115 169 Dry beans, excl. dry limas....farms.. 67 87 acres.. 8 663 9 692 cwt.. 134 784 133 319 Hay-alf, other, wild, silage..farms.. 121 131 acres.. 9 751 10 036 tons, dry.. 20 428 22 174 Vegetables harvested..........farms.. 27 36 acres.. 1 857 2 027 Land in orchards..............farms.. 4 8 acres.. 31 49 @1Data are based on a sample of farms. Legend: (D) Withheld to avoid disclosing data for individual farms (X) Not applicable (Z) Less than half the unit shown (NA) Not available Source: 1997 Census of Agriculture, Volume 1 Geographic Area Series, "Table 1. County Summary Highlights: 1997." This electronic series presents summary statistics for each county and State together with comparable data from the 1992 census. The items included are the same for all States and counties, except selected crops harvested, which vary by State. Data for 1997 and 1992 are directly comparable for acreage and inventories. Dollar values have not been adjusted for changes in price levels. You can obtain the Volume 1 Geographic Area Series from the National Technical Information Service.
